Oak Island appears to have been an important naval operations base for various sides of the conflict for world domination, functioning as a dry dock for ship repair, maybe a place where you …Oak Island is a 57-hectare (140-acre) island in Lunenburg County on the south shore of Nova Scotia, Canada. The tree-covered island is one of about 360 small islands in Mahone Bay and rises to a maximum of 11 metres …Biography . "For more than one hundred and seventy years hosts of eager treasure ...Title: Oak Island Map, 1961. Author: George Bates. Story: Historical Map of the Island drawn by George Bates in 1961. Bates was known for his dry-dock theory of the island. He first surveyed Oak Island in 1937 and would later become a Secretary for the Nova Scotia Historical Society. She chose this school in part because she grew up in a nearby town.Oak Island is connected to the Nova Scotia mainland by road. As this is a rural area, public transport is scant, and the best way to arrive is by car. Driving the 47 miles (76 kilometers) from Halifax takes about 60–70 minutes.
